Kaibeto Senior Center is a vital organization within the 56th Chapter of the Great Navajo Nation, dedicated to providing a range of benefits and services to elders living on the Navajo Nation. Their mission is to ensure that elders receive the support they are entitled to, while preserving their dignity, self-respect, and cultural identity.
With a vision to offer on-site and home-delivered meals, transportation, and various supportive services, Kaibeto Senior Center also aims to provide recreational, social, educational, and health activities for elders. They prioritize information referral, nutrition education, transportation, social activities, and the provision of congregate and home-delivered meals, as well as adaptive devices and outreach.
